Social Impact Program Development:
At the heart of corporate philanthropy lies social impact program development, a strategic endeavor aimed at addressing pressing social and environmental challenges while aligning with organizational values and objectives. Whether focused on education, healthcare, environmental sustainability, or economic empowerment, effective program development entails rigorous needs assessment, stakeholder engagement, and the formulation of clear goals and metrics for success.
Program Scaling:
As social programs evolve and demonstrate efficacy, the need for program scaling becomes apparent, allowing organizations to extend their reach and maximize impact. Scaling involves expanding program operations, partnerships, and resources to serve larger populations or address broader issues. This may entail replicating successful initiatives in new geographic areas, forging strategic alliances with other organizations, or securing additional funding and support from stakeholders.

Regulatory Impacts:
Navigating the regulatory landscape is a critical aspect of social impact program development, as compliance with legal requirements and industry standards is essential for sustainability and credibility. Regulatory considerations encompass a range of issues, including tax implications of charitable contributions, compliance with labor laws related to volunteerism, and adherence to regulations governing nonprofit organizations and corporate social responsibility reporting.

1. Developing Expertise in Social Impact Program Development
Effective Social Impact Program Development requires a deep understanding of social issues, stakeholder dynamics, and program design principles. SVC Training equips team members with the knowledge and skills needed to assess community needs,
design evidence-based interventions, set measurable goals, and develop sustainable program models. Training modules may include needs assessment techniques, logic model development, theory of change frameworks, and impact measurement methodologies.
